- The challenge was: partycode my first 4k from scratch.
@sensenstahl Well there is a small story behind the "annoying" part of the intro. The concept was that it would stop when the stars filled the screen, and that it would have no "music" at all. At the very last moment my shaders didn't work anymore with my 4k framework (god knows why) I decided to use Compofiller Studio as you can basically drop in a shader that works on shadertoy. One small detail: it requires you to include a 4klang song. So in literally a quarter I tried to figure out 4klang, looked for some program that works with it (OpenMPT did luckily), and produced a "song" so Compofiller Studio would not complain. All in all I am happy that it made the bigscreen. - isokadded on the 2019-04-27 20:25:09
